Since roughly 02:10 local time, the Parkhaven occupancy feed for the Deck C sensor cluster has been emitting negative available-space counts, which the mobile display clamps to zero but the analytics pipeline ingests raw. Suspected cause: the exit-gate counter reset during the overnight firmware push while the entry counter did not. On-call: restart the aggregator with the `--rebaseline` flag during a low-traffic window. Attach the trace token below when updating this ticket.

build token for yajof-bajof: htk31_506ff1188f74596b5bb2eec94edc43c

Audit item 7: Queue-depth autoscaler (Millbranch worker fleet). Verify scale-up triggers at the documented depth threshold with the 90-second cooldown intact, and confirm the scale-down floor cannot drop below two workers. Review the flap-protection logic added after the Tarnow overload and check that metrics emission survives scaler restarts. Evidence should include load-test traces. The reviewer must obtain countersignature from the component owner named below.

account owner for bawip-tahag: Raleth Quenok

## Runbook: Hooksend Webhook Retries

Deliveries retry up to six times with exponential backoff, capped at one hour. After the final failure, events move to the parked queue for manual replay. Never replay parked events without checking consumer health first. To query delivery attempts and parked events, connect using the string below.

database URL for haduf-tajof: redis://holox_svc:c9@db-3fb6.lumicworks.local:5432/fraeth

## Formula sandbox tuning

User-supplied formulas in Gridmoor execute inside a restricted interpreter with hard ceilings on time, memory, and call depth. Reviewers should confirm any change to these ceilings is justified in the PR description, since raising them widens the abuse surface. Defaults were chosen from production traces. The current limits are as follows.

limits module of tafog-fawip:
WEIGHTS = {
    "julix": 57,
    "lamys": 992,
    "kasvan": 209,
    "quenok": 750,
    "alddor": 259,
    "oliath": 1009,
    "wenix": 815,
}